http://www.buletinonline.net/images/stories/aberita3/masjid%20saujana.jpgSetiu – A healthy newborn girl baby was found in a mosque at Kampung Saujana, Setiu, early this morning Wednesday 19 September.

Terengganu CID Chief ACP K. Manoharan said the baby was found by the imam and ustaz of the mosque at about 6am when both went to the mosque to perform the Subuh prayers.

Upon entering the prayer area for men, they were shocked to find a baby girl wrapped in an orange coloured towel.

“Based on blood stains and intact umbilical cord, we believe the baby was just born. We are still trying to identify the parents of the baby,” he told reporters here today.

Manoharan said the baby weighing 3.4kg was later sent to the Setiu Hospital for a medical checkup.

He also urged anyone with information to come forward and contact the nearest police station. Bernama
